Meaning of Partnership Partnership is the relationship between two or more person who agrees to carry on a business and share the profit or losses of the business equally or in an agreed ratio. The business may be carried on by all the partners jointly or any one or more of them on behalf of all the partners. Pankaj Saikia-2021
Features of Partnership There must be two or more person. Agreement among partners. (Oral or Written) A business with profit motive. Sharing of profit and losses. Partners jointly shares unlimited liability. Relationship of Principal and Agent among the Partners. (Mutual Agency). Maximum number of members is 50 as per section 464 0f Companies Act 2013. Partnership Deed Partnership deed is the set of terms and conditions on which the partners agrees orally or in written to carry on a business. A deed is not mandatory by any law but it is desirable to avoid and resolve any dispute or misunderstanding among the partners. Pankaj Saikia-2021
Contents of Partnership Deed. Name of the firm and nature of business. Name and address of the partners. Profit sharing Ratio. Interest on Capital and Drawings. Interest on Loan by partners to firm. Remuneration (salary or Commission) to partners. Contribution to Capital by Partners. Management of business and Audit. Pankaj Saikia-2021
Rules to be followed in absence/ silence of Partnership Deed. Profit and losses should be shared equally. No interest on capital should be allowed. Interest on capital should be paid out of profit only even if provided by deed. No interest will be charged on Drawings. Interest will be provided @ 6% per annum on Loan by partners to firm. New partners can be appointed only with the consent of all the partners Every Partner has the right to take part in management of business. Interest on Capital. Interest on capital is an appropriation (expenditure) of profit payable to partners by firm. Allowed only when it is provided by partnership deed or all the partners agrees to provide. No interest on Capital is paid if it is not permitted by Partnership Deed or the Deed is silent in this regard. It is paid out of profit only unless it is otherwise specified by the Partnership Deed. It is usually calculated on the opening balance of capital by taking in to account the addition to and withdrawal from capital. (Time Adjusted) Pankaj Saikia-2021
Interest on Drawings. Interest on drawings is an appropriation (income) of profit & loss payable by partners to firm. It is charged only when it is provided by partnership deed or all the partners agrees to it. No interest on Drawing is charged if it is not provided by Partnership Deed or the Deed is silent in this regard. It is charged irrespective of profit or loss in a particular financial year. It is calculated exactly on the amount withdrawn and from the from the time of withdrawal till the date of closing the accounts. Pankaj Saikia-2021

PARTNERS CAPITAL ACCOUNT. In accounting of Partnership firm preparation of Capital Account of partners is a special aspect. Capital account is started with Opening capital of Partners (usually Credit Balance). Addition to Capital, Interest on capital, Share of profit, Salary or commission to partners are the common items Credited to Partners Capital Account. Withdrawal of capital, Drawings, Interest on Drawings, Share of loss etc. are common item Debited to Capital Account of Partners. Capital Account can be maintained as Fixed as well as Fluctuating. P/L APPROPRIATION ACCOUNT. Profit and Loss Appropriation Account is merely an extension of the Profit and Loss Account of the firm. It shows how the profits are appropriated or distributed among the partners. All adjustments in respect of partner’s salary, partner’s commission, interest on capital, interest on drawings, etc. are made through this account. It starts with the Net Profit (Credit Side)/Net Loss (Debit Side) as per Profit and Loss Account. Pankaj Saikia-2021
